A shock-free approach for ambulatory cardioversion in atrial fibrillation
1Laboratory of Experimental Cardiology, Department of Cardiology, Leiden University Medical Center, Leiden, The Netherlands.
Abstract:
Atrial fibrillation (AF), the most common persistent arrhythmia, is terminated most effectively by electrical cardioversion. This therapy requires in-hospital sedation to relieve the pain caused by electric shocks. Recently, our research group showed how the heart itself could be enabled to detect and terminate arrhythmias, including AF, thereby revealing the discovery of fully biological, shock-free cardioversion. Because of its biological nature, neither electric shocks nor hardware/software is required for sinus rhythm (SR) restoration, which creates a new perspective for ambulatory AF termination. Increasing evidence suggests that patients may indeed benefit from such continuous real-time rhythm control.
